What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Network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Network Engineer, you need a solid understanding of networking protocols, troubleshooting, and infrastructure, typically sup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with networking hardware, Cisco or Juniper devices, and certifications like CCNA or CompTIA Network+ are highly valued.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help in diagnosing issues and collaborating with IT teams. These competencies are essential for maintaining secure, efficient, and reliable network operations critical to organizational performance.

How does a networking professional typically collaborate with other IT teams within an organization?

Networking professionals frequently work alongside system administrators, security teams, and help desk staff to ensure smooth and secure operation of an organization's IT infrastructure. Collaboration often involves troubleshooting connectivity issues, implementing network upgrades, and ensuring network security protocols are properly integrated with other systems. Effective communication and teamwork are essential, as network changes can impact multiple departments. Regular meetings, cross-functional projects, and coordinated response to incidents are common ways networking professionals interact with peers across IT.

What are networking professionals?

Networking professionals are specialists who design, implement, manage, and troubleshoot computer networks within organizations. They ensure reliable communication and data sharing between devices, maintain network security, and optimize network performance. These professionals may work with local area networks (LANs), wide area networks (WANs), cloud networks, and other related technologies. Their roles often include tasks such as configuring routers and switches, monitoring network traffic, and resolving connectivity issues. Networking professionals are essential for keeping businesses and organizations connected and secure in today's digital world.

What careers are there in networking?

Careers in networking include roles such as network administrator, network engineer, systems analyst, and cybersecurity specialist. These positions typically require knowledge of networking protocols, hardware, and security tools, and often benefit from certifications like Cisco CCNA or CompTIA Network+.

    About the role and what you'll be doing: 

    The Onsite Desktop Support Engineer manages the full physical and digital lifecycle of company hardware and software. This role balances high-volume equipment provisioning (imaging and shipping) with expert technical support. You will ensure that workstations are perfectly configured before deployment and remain functional through proactive Microsoft 365 management and comprehensive onsite/remote troubleshooting

    We want all new Associates to succeed in their roles at Ensono. That's why we've outlined the job requirements below. To be considered for this role, it's important that you meet all Required Qualifications. If you do not meet all of the Preferred Qualifications, we still encourage you to apply. 

     

    Key Responsibilities

    • Microsoft 365 Administration: Manage user accounts, licenses, and group memberships within the M365 Admin Center; troubleshoot issues with Outlook profiles, OneDrive sync errors, and Teams connectivity.

    • Hardware Provisioning & Imaging: Execute the end-to-end setup of laptops and desktops using deployment tools (e.g., SCCM, Intune, Autopilot); ensure all OS patches, drivers, and core applications are verified before the device leaves the bench.

    • Logistics & Shipment: Securely package, label, and track hardware shipments to remote employees, ensuring "out-of-the-box" readiness and zero transit damage.

    • Remote Technical Troubleshooting: Support offsite employees via remote desktop tools (e.g., TeamViewer, Quick Assist) to resolve software conflicts, VPN connectivity, and M365 application crashes.

    • Onsite "White Glove" Support: Provide walk-up or desk-side assistance for local office staff, resolving hardware failures, docking station connectivity, and conference room A/V issues.

    • Connectivity & Network Support: Troubleshoot local LAN/Wi-Fi issues onsite and guide remote users through home-network optimization for stable cloud-app performance.

    • Asset & Inventory Management: Maintain a meticulous log of all hardware assets, tracking "in-flight" shipments, onsite spares, and retired equipment in the ITSM (e.g., ServiceNow or Jira).

    • Break/Fix & Maintenance: Perform hardware repairs (RAM upgrades, screen replacements) and manage the secure decommissioning/wiping of legacy drives.
